Abstract

An automated license plate recognition (ALPR) system and method using a human-in-the-loop based adaptive learning approach. One or more images with respect to an automotive vehicle can be segmented in order to determine a license plate of the automotive vehicle within a scene. An optical character recognition (OCR) engine loaded with an OCR algorithm can be further adapted to determine a character sequence of the license plate based on a training data set. A confidence level with respect to the images can be generated in order to route a low confidence image to an operator for obtaining a human interpreted image. The parameters with respect to the OCR algorithm can be adjusted based on the human interpreted image and the actual image of the license plate. A license plate design can be then incorporated into the OCR engine in order to automate the process of recognizing the license plate with respect to the automotive vehicle in a wide range of transportation related applications.
